Tips For Finding And Wearing Plus Size Apparel In Logan, Utah
Living in a mountain town means you need pieces that shift with changing weather and local life. Here are a few friendly tips to help you build a plus size wardrobe that feels right at home in Logan.
- Shop local boutiques near Utah State University to discover sizes beyond the usual racks and support the community.
- Look for fabrics with stretch and breathability so you stay comfy on canyon hikes and campus strolls.
- Layer light jackets and cardigans to peel off or add on as temperatures swing from morning chill to midday sun.
- Embrace patterns and pops of color to stand out against Logan’s snowy winters or blooming spring fields.
- Don’t skip the fit guide—asking store staff for sizing advice can save you time and frustration.
